One of my clients switched from cbeyond to another provider and just
like that lost email notifications coming from their ecommerce site.
The site is hosted by rackforce. I have access to the plesk panel and
shell access to the site. I ought to be able to do command line mail
be doing:
mail bobm at dottedi.biz <cr> etc...
This fails with no obvious error; I tried doing mail -v to see a verbose
output but apparently wrong argument.
I also made up a very simple php file which when accessed should send me
a test message. It also fails, something like:
<?php
$message = "Email body/contents";
$subject = "Test of php email script";
$to = "bobm at dottedi.biz";
$from = "From: admin at wherever.com";
mail ($to, $subject, $body, $from);
?>
No dice of course. Finally within zen-cart itself I found the
configuration item for the mail server which was originally set to
"mail.west.cbeyond.com" and changed it to: "smtp.integra.net" and the
dice remain silent.
What are some UNIX/Linux command line tests I can do to determine the
root cause? As I have access to Plesk, is there anything in the control
panel that needs to be changed that might still be referencing cbeyond?
